シバイヌ(SHIB)スマートコントラクトの応用例紹介
はじめに
シバイヌ(SHIB)は、2020年に誕生した分散型暗号資産であり、当初は「ドージコインキラー」として位置づけられました。しかし、その後の発展は単なるミームコインの域を超え、独自の生態系を構築し、多様な応用事例を生み出しています。その中心となるのが、シバイヌネットワーク上で動作するスマートコントラクトです。本稿では、シバイヌのスマートコントラクトの技術的な概要と、具体的な応用例について詳細に解説します。シバイヌのスマートコントラクトは、イーサリアム仮想マシン(EVM)互換性を持つため、既存のEVMベースのアプリケーションを比較的容易に移植できるという利点があります。これにより、開発者は既存のツールやライブラリを活用し、迅速にシバイヌネットワーク上でアプリケーションを構築できます。
シバイヌスマートコントラクトの技術的概要
シバイヌネットワークは、当初イーサリアムブロックチェーン上にERC-20トークンとして実装されました。その後、Layer-2ソリューションであるShibariumの導入により、スケーラビリティとトランザクションコストの削減を実現しました。Shibariumは、Polygon Edgeをベースとしたカスタムブロックチェーンであり、EVM互換性を維持しています。シバイヌのスマートコントラクトは、主にShibarium上で開発・実行されます。スマートコントラクトの開発言語としては、Solidityが一般的に使用されます。Solidityは、EVM上で動作するスマートコントラクトを記述するための高水準言語であり、豊富なライブラリとツールが提供されています。シバイヌのスマートコントラクトは、トークン標準(ERC-20など)に準拠しているだけでなく、独自の機能やロジックを追加することで、多様な応用を実現しています。例えば、自動流動性提供(Automated Market Maker: AMM)や分散型金融(Decentralized Finance: DeFi)プロトコル、非代替性トークン(Non-Fungible Token: NFT)マーケットプレイスなどが挙げられます。
シバイヌスマートコントラクトの応用例
1. SHIBSwap
SHIBSwapは、シバイヌエコシステムの中核となる分散型取引所(DEX)です。スマートコントラクトを活用することで、ユーザーはシバイヌトークン(SHIB)、レオンドトークン(LEO)、ボーントークン(BONE)などのトークンをスワップしたり、流動性を提供したり、ファーミングに参加したりすることができます。SHIBSwapのスマートコントラクトは、AMMモデルを採用しており、流動性プロバイダーは取引手数料の一部を受け取ることができます。また、ファーミング機能を利用することで、流動性を提供したユーザーは追加の報酬としてSHIBトークンを獲得することができます。SHIBSwapは、ユーザーフレンドリーなインターフェースと低い取引手数料を特徴としており、シバイヌエコシステムにおける取引の中心的な役割を果たしています。
2. TREATトークンとBoosted Farming
TREATトークンは、シバイヌエコシステムに新たに導入されたトークンであり、SHIBSwapにおけるファーミング報酬のブースト機能を提供します。TREATトークンを保有することで、ファーミング報酬を増やすことができ、より多くのSHIBトークンを獲得することができます。この機能は、スマートコントラクトによって実装されており、TREATトークンの保有量に応じてファーミング報酬が調整されます。Boosted Farmingは、シバイヌエコシステムの流動性提供を促進し、長期的な成長を支援することを目的としています。
3. Shibarium上のNFTマーケットプレイス
Shibariumは、NFTの作成、取引、管理を容易にするためのインフラを提供します。シバイヌエコシステムでは、Shibarium上で動作するNFTマーケットプレイスが開発されており、ユーザーは独自のNFTを作成したり、他のユーザーのNFTを購入したり、販売したりすることができます。NFTマーケットプレイスのスマートコントラクトは、NFTの所有権の移転、取引の実行、ロイヤリティの分配などを自動的に処理します。これにより、NFTの取引を安全かつ効率的に行うことができます。シバイヌエコシステムのNFTマーケットプレイスは、アート、ゲーム、音楽など、多様な分野のNFTを取り扱うことが期待されています。
4. 分散型ゲーム(GameFi)
シバイヌエコシステムは、分散型ゲーム(GameFi)の分野にも進出しています。スマートコントラクトを活用することで、ゲーム内のアイテムやキャラクターをNFTとして表現し、ユーザーはこれらのNFTを所有したり、取引したりすることができます。また、ゲーム内の報酬としてSHIBトークンを獲得することも可能です。分散型ゲームは、従来のゲームとは異なり、ユーザーがゲームの経済活動に参加し、報酬を獲得できるという特徴があります。シバイヌエコシステムの分散型ゲームは、ユーザーエンゲージメントを高め、コミュニティの活性化に貢献することが期待されています。
5. 分散型自律組織(DAO)
シバイヌエコシステムは、分散型自律組織(DAO)の構築も検討しています。DAOは、スマートコントラクトによって管理される組織であり、メンバーの投票によって意思決定が行われます。シバイヌエコシステムのDAOは、エコシステムの開発方向や資金配分などを決定するために活用される可能性があります。DAOのスマートコントラクトは、投票の実施、投票結果の集計、意思決定の実行などを自動的に処理します。これにより、透明性と公平性を確保し、コミュニティの意見を反映した意思決定を行うことができます。
6. その他の応用例
上記以外にも、シバイヌのスマートコントラクトは、様々な応用例が考えられます。例えば、サプライチェーン管理、デジタルアイデンティティ、投票システム、保険契約などです。スマートコントラクトの柔軟性と自動化機能は、これらの分野における効率性と透明性を向上させることができます。シバイヌエコシステムは、これらの応用例を積極的に探索し、新たな価値を創造することを目指しています。
スマートコントラクトのセキュリティに関する考慮事項
スマートコントラクトは、一度デプロイされると変更が困難であるため、セキュリティ上の脆弱性が存在すると、重大な損失につながる可能性があります。シバイヌのスマートコントラクトの開発においては、セキュリティを最優先事項として考慮する必要があります。具体的には、以下の対策を講じることが重要です。
- 厳格なコードレビュー: 経験豊富な開発者によるコードレビューを実施し、潜在的な脆弱性を特定します。
- 形式検証: 数学的な手法を用いて、スマートコントラクトの正当性を検証します。
- 監査: 外部のセキュリティ監査機関にスマートコントラクトの監査を依頼し、専門的な視点から脆弱性を評価します。
- バグバウンティプログラム: セキュリティ研究者にスマートコントラクトの脆弱性を発見してもらい、報奨金を提供します。
- 継続的な監視: スマートコントラクトの動作を継続的に監視し、異常な挙動を検知します。
今後の展望
シバイヌのスマートコントラクトは、今後も進化を続け、より多様な応用事例を生み出すことが期待されます。Shibariumのさらなる発展、EVM互換性の向上、開発ツールの充実などが、スマートコントラクトの普及を促進するでしょう。また、シバイヌエコシステムとの連携を強化し、新たな価値を創造することが重要です。分散型ゲーム、NFT、DAOなどの分野におけるイノベーションは、シバイヌエコシステムの成長を加速させるでしょう。シバイヌのスマートコントラクトは、単なる暗号資産の枠を超え、Web3.0時代の基盤技術として、社会に貢献していくことが期待されます。
まとめ
シバイヌ(SHIB)のスマートコントラクトは、SHIBSwapのような分散型取引所から、NFTマーケットプレイス、分散型ゲーム、DAOなど、多岐にわたる応用例を持っています。Shibariumの導入により、スケーラビリティとトランザクションコストの削減を実現し、より多くの開発者がシバイヌネットワーク上でアプリケーションを構築できるようになりました。セキュリティ対策を徹底し、継続的な開発とイノベーションを通じて、シバイヌのスマートコントラクトは、Web3.0時代の重要な要素となるでしょう。シバイヌエコシステムの成長とともに、スマートコントラクトの可能性はさらに広がっていくと期待されます。